Abstract
⺠T-Nb2O5 and rutile are the main components of the oxidized β-TiNb alloy surface. ⺠Negative value of ζ potential is reduced by presence of Nb in the alloy surface. ⺠Less negative ζ potential is beneficial for interaction of the alloy with cells. ⺠The β-TiNb alloy is promising material as a substitute of Ti-6Al-4V alloy.
